The Thought Leader Liaison (TLL) role is a senior field-based position within the US commercial organization that will focus on commercial KOL relationship engagement, promotional speaker training and development, and supports the execution of promotional patient programs The position will report to the Director TLL and is a field-based extension of the marketing team. 

Responsibilities: 

  • Develop and maintain KOL Engagement Plans for thought leaders  
  • Plan and execute National and Regional Congress Engagement Plan with a focus on meaningful engagements with senior leadership and in support of marketing initiatives  

  • Support commercial KOL influence mapping initiatives by developing profiles  

  • Monitor KOL insights about current and future treatment patterns that may impact the commercial strategy and provide feedback for consideration 

  • Act as liaison between KOLs and Alexion for on label activities, including office-based cross-functional colleagues and teams  

  • Assist in the facilitation and execution of commercial advisory boards through identification of key advisors equipped to provide compelling insights  

  • Align with field partners such as Medical Science Liaisons on complementary initiatives with shared customers  

  • Work with Marketing and Sales Management to identify and recruit KOLs for national and regional faculty and speaker bureaus  

  • Trains physician speakers on approved promotional slide decks 

  • Develops physician speakers to provide high quality promotional education 

  • Ensures appropriate and compliant execution of speaker programs 

  • Monitors speaker performance at live programs 

  • Work with marketing and contracted speakers to gain and synthesize feedback in support of the evolution of promotional programming content, case studies for potential publications, and other commercial projects  

  • Provides field-based training on speaker programs for when needed (focus on community based promotional speakers not covered by MSLs) 

  • Creates and executes local promotional patient engagement plans and programs 

  • Provides input and support in developing account plans 

  • Provides field-based training when needed 

  • Address customer service issues/identified needs and coordinate cross-functional action plans to address on label issue as needed 

  • Works with cross-functional teams to provide key customer insights and input on strategy, tactics, and messaging, and program execution 

  • Works with the highest degree of professionalism and in accordance with the company’s code of Ethics and Business Conduct

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
